How the data is fetched from the cube for reporting - with and without BIA

hi all,
I need to understand the below scenario:(as to how the data is fetched from the cube for reporting)
I have a query, on a multiprovider connected to cubes say A and B. A is on BIA index, B is not. There are no aggregates created on both the cubes.
CASE 1: I have taken RSRT stats with BIA on, in aggregation layer it says
Basic InfoProvider     *****Table type      ***** Viewed at      ***** Records, Selected     *****Records, Transported
Cube A     ***** blank ***** 0.624305      ***** 8,087,502      ***** 2,011
Cube B     ***** E ***** 42.002653 ***** 1,669,126      ***** 6
Cube B     ***** F ***** 98.696442 ***** 2,426,006 ***** 6
CASE 2:I have taken the RSRT stats, disabling the BIA index, in aggregation layer it says:
Basic InfoProvider     *****Table Type     *****Viewed at     *****Records, Selected     *****Records, Transported
Cube B     *****E     *****46.620825     ****1,669,126****     6
Cube B     *****F     ****106.148337****     2,426,030*****     6
Cube A     *****E     *****61.939073     *****3,794,113     *****3,499
Cube A     *****F     ****90.721171****     4,293,420     *****5,584
now my question is why is here a huge difference in the number of records transported for cube A when compared to case 1. The input criteria for both the cases are the same and the result output is matching. There is no change in the number of records selected for cube A in both cases.It is 8,087,502 in both cases.
Can someone pls clarify on this difference in records being selected.

Hi,
yes, Vitaliy could be guess right. Please check if FEMS compression is enabled (note 1308274).
What you can do to get more details about the selection is to activate the execurtion plan SQL/BWA queries in data manager. You can also activate the trace functions for BWA in RSRT. So you need to know how both queries select its data.
Regards,
Jens

Similar Messages

  • How the data is fetched from the cube for reporting

    hi all,
    I need to understand the below scenario:(as to how the data is fetched from the cube for reporting)
    I have a query, on a multiprovider connected to cubes say A and B. A is on BIA index, B is not. There are no aggregates created on both the cubes.
    CASE 1:  I have taken RSRT stats with BIA on, in aggregation layer it says
    Basic InfoProvider     *****Table type      ***** Viewed at          ***** Records, Selected     *****Records, Transported
    Cube A     *****             blank                 *****           0.624305         *****          8,087,502        *****             2,011
    Cube B     *****                     E   *****                      42.002653  *****                  1,669,126            *****                    6
    Cube B     *****                     F  *****                     98.696442    *****                  2,426,006       *****                    6
    CASE 2:I have taken the RSRT stats, disabling the BIA index, in aggregation layer it says:
    Basic InfoProvider     *****Table Type     *****Viewed at     *****Records, Selected     *****Records, Transported
    Cube B     *****E     *****46.620825     ****1,669,126****     6
    Cube B     *****F     ****106.148337****     2,426,030*****     6
    Cube A     *****E     *****61.939073     *****3,794,113     *****3,499
    Cube A     *****F     ****90.721171****     4,293,420     *****5,584
    now my question is why is here a huge difference in the number of records transported for cube A when compared to case 1. The input criteria for both the cases are the same and the result output is matching. There is no change in the number of records selected for cube A in both cases.It is 8,087,502 in both cases.
    Can someone pls clarify on this difference in records being selected.

    Hi Jay,
    Thanks for sharing your analysis.
    The only reason I could think logically is BWA is having information in both E and F tables in one place and hence after selecting the records, it is able to aggregate and transport the reords to OLAP.
    In the second case, since E and F tables are separate, aggregation might be happening at OLAP and hence you see more number of records.
    Our Experts in BWA forum might be able to answer in a better way, if you post this question over there.
    Thanks,
    Krishnan

  • How to remove the DATA Provider(Query) from the WAD 3.5

    Hi,
         I want to remove the unused dataprovider(query) from the WAD 3.5,
         How to delete the dataprovider.
    Please suggest here

    Go to HTML tab. You will see all the data providers on top. You can delete the unused ones there.

  • I am not getting the data in Bex from the cube

    Hi Experts,
    i am not getting the data from the cube to Bex,
    cube having the data, but i am not able to see this data in the Bex result area.
    Can  any one help me.
    Best regards,
    Bhaskar

    Hi
    In the manage cube, is reporting symbol is there for your requests
    If you have any red requests delete them and refresh
    If all requests having reporting symbols you may check the BEx without any filters or selection criterions
    Regards
    N Ganesh

  • I am attempting to make a 2013 calendar from my 2009and wanted to transfer material but all the dates have disappeared from the caldendar pages.  I know they must be there.  How do I retrieve so I do not have to retype info.?

    I am attempting to transfer material from a 2009 calendar project to my 2013 but seem to have lot the printed date info from the original project.  Any idea How I might recover it?

    Alright, I got the centering figured out, so this is what ive got so far-
       import javax.swing.*;
       import java.awt.*;
       import java.lang.Math;
        public class Memory extends java.applet.Applet
          private int xMouse;
          private int yMouse;
          private boolean mouseClicked = false;
          private boolean firstRun = true;
          private static final int WIDTH = 100;
           public void init()
             setBackground(Color.BLACK);       
           public void paint(Graphics canvas)
             if(firstRun)
                buildBoard(4);
                firstRun = false;
             else
                displayGame(canvas);
                if (mouseClicked)
                   displayHit(canvas);
                   mouseClicked = false;
           public boolean mouseDown(Event e, int x, int y )
             mouseClicked = true;
             xMouse = x;
             yMouse = y;
             repaint();
             return true;
           public void update ( Graphics g )
             paint(g);
           public void buildBoard(int s)
           public void displayGame(Graphics canvas)
             canvas.setColor(Color.WHITE);
             for(int i =0; i < 400; i+= WIDTH)
                for(int j = 0; j < 400; j+= WIDTH)
                   canvas.drawRect(i, j, WIDTH, WIDTH);
           public void displayHit(Graphics g)
             g.setColor(Color.BLUE);
             int x = xMouse / WIDTH;
             x *= WIDTH;
             int y = yMouse / WIDTH;
             y *= WIDTH;
             g.fillOval(x+30, y+30, 40, 40);
       }

  • I want to connect my personal iPhone 4 to my work computer as my original computer died. I do NOT want the dates or contact from the Outlook Calender on my phone though it says I need to make a contact or it will delete what I have on my iPhone. ?? help!

    So how can I sync and not lose my contacts/calendar, I am confused.

    Another thing to remember is the phone is actually usable for 911 calls and maybe others. Not a real good idea. Especially for a child.
    It would depend however on the age of the child.
    Good Luck

  • When i sync my pc with my ipod the data dont transfer from the pc

    I have software Itune 10.7 and my new ipod gen.5 with ios 6.0.1
    My problem is that I have loaded music and videos into my itune on my PC, when I then plug in my ipod tuch it sync but I am not able to find the music or videos on my Ipod ?

    I have the same problem!

  • How to display YUV stream from a video card into javafx and without JMF?

    Hello,
    I try to display in a player a yuv stream gotten from a video capture card.... Is there a means to perform this in javafx?
    regards

    Thanks for the pointer ; unfortunately I haven't find yet the alexfromsorkoland post about the topic you mentionned.
    I'll try tomorrow another way of doing...
    Basically I get yuv frames from video capture card... I've to translate these into RBG frame and then convert them into images I can display at a specific rate.
    We can do this by using the hidden classes of JMF like com.sun.media.codec.video.colorspace.YUV2RBG and the javax.media.util.BufferToImage.BufferToImage. I've just now to find how to build the buffer needed for the YUV2RBG :-(
    regards

  • How to Combine 2  dimensions in ASO cube for Reporting

    Hello,
    We have several OBIEE reports being extracted out of ASO Essbase cube through the RDP Layer.
    The requirement by a new report is to Combine two dimension in the Underlying ASO cube.
    The following two dimension needs to be combined into one, using MDX intersection
    PRODUCT
      - OIL
      - GAS
    REGION
      - APAC
      - AMEA
    Combined Dimension
       - OIL_APAC   [MDX]
       - GAS_APAC [ MDX]
    Can you please help me the MDX syntax for acheiving the above
    Cheers
    MS

    Hi,
    Thank you for sharing this with us, and it will help others who have met with this issue.
    Victoria
    Forum Support
    Please remember to mark the replies as answers if they help and unmark them if they provide no help. If you have feedback for TechNet Subscriber Support, contact
    [email protected]
    Victoria Xia
    TechNet Community Support

  • The sound on my laptop has stopped working entirely, with and without headphones.  What should I do?

    The sound on my computer has stopped working.  I have searched through countles google entries to try and figure out the problem but I can't find anything remotely useful.  I never spilled any liquid or anything on my computer.  I was just searching through youtube and when I clicked a video there was no sound.  Then I checked iTunes and tried to play some music, still no sound.  I played around with the preferences and volume control, still no sound.  If you have any advice please help.  Going to the apple store is so expensive and I don't have the time or money.

    Did you try resetting PRAM and SMC?
    Is there any red light visible in the headphone port?

  • How to ensure that the query results are fetched from the BW acclerator.

    Hi Experts,
    Suppose if i want to execute the query with BIA option, I can achieve it in RSRT .
    1)But is there some query settings or properties where we can make sure that whenever a query(say Q1) is executed, always the data should be fetched from the BIA index.
    2)Suppose the BIA indexing has failed due  to some reasons, will the data be fetched from the previously updated BIA index??
    regards
    akshay

    Hi man,
    1)But is there some query settings or properties where we can make sure that whenever a query(say Q1) is executed, always the data should be fetched from the BIA index.
    If you have built up BIA index on a cube, then every query on the cube or MultiProvider will automatically use BIA index. No additional settings required. You can use the following way to test whether a query is using BIA or not:
    Go to RSRT, input query name, click 'execute and debug' and check 'Display Statistics Data' and 'Do Not Use Cache'. Execute. After the query result press F3, now you should be able to see statistics. There's a tab 'BIA Access'. If you see something there then it means BIA index is used.
    2)Suppose the BIA indexing has failed due to some reasons, will the data be fetched from the previously updated BIA index??
    If BIA rollup is failed, then the last request(s) would not available in reporting and query will use BIA index for earlier requests. You can consider it like aggregate. But if initial fill of BIA failed then you would not be able to use BIA index.
    Regards,
    Frank
    Edited by: Frank Lee on Jul 14, 2009 2:22 PM

  • Problem in getting the Date object based on the TimeZone

    Hi,
    I need to create a Date object that holds the time of the specified TimeZone.
    I am using TimeZone and Calendar object for that, but when I call the Calendar object's getTime() method, it returns
    a Date object that holds the local time.
    Can somebody let me know what why?
    Here is what I uses in my code.
    TimeZone tz = TimeZone.getTimeZone("IST");
    Calendar cal = new GregorianCalendar(tz);
    System.out.println("Date of "IST" TimeZone = " + cal.getTime());
    Instead of cal.getTime, if I do the following I am getting the values correctly.
    int month = cal.get(Calendar.MONTH); // 0..11
    int day = cal.get(Calendar.DATE); // 0..11
    int hour12 = cal.get(Calendar.HOUR); // 0..11
    int minutes = cal.get(Calendar.MINUTE); // 0..59
    Can somebody let me know why I am not able to assign the Date of the TimeZone specified.
    Is there anything wrong with the code?
    Seb

    Is there anything wrong with the code?No, only with your understanding of the Date class. From the API:
    The class Date represents a specific instant in time, with millisecond precision.
    The different time displayed for different TimeZones around the world are just that: a display format for the same instant in time.
    To display the "instant in time" in a different TimeZone, use DateFormat. Here's a small sample:TimeZone tz = TimeZone.getTimeZone ("GMT");
    Calendar c = Calendar.getInstance (tz);
    System.out.println(c.getTime ()); // prints Tue Mar 18 02:56:53 IST 2008
    DateFormat dtf = DateFormat.getTimeInstance ();
    dtf.setTimeZone (tz);
    System.out.println(dtf.format (c.getTime ())); // prints 9:26:53 PMIt's no different from formatting the same number in various ways: 10 decimal == 0xA hexadecimal == 012 octal == 1010 binary. Same value, different representation. Same intant in time, different local time for each zone.
    Savvy?
    cheers, db

  • How do i sync calendar form outlook 2011 for MAC with my nokia lumia 1020?

    How do I sync the calendar info etc from outlook 2011 for MAC with my nokia lumia 1020 - I assume there's a way through outlook.com but I can't find the answer anywhere.  Thank you!

    So you are using an Outlook.com account?
    Please take a look at this article and see if it is helpful to you:
    http://www.windowsphone.com/en-us/how-to/wp7/people/sync-calendars-and-to-dos
    When you set up an account from Outlook or Windows Live, the calendar associated with that account will be synced to your phone and will automatically stay in sync.
    By the way, this is the forum to discuss questions and feedback for Windows-based Microsoft Office client. Since your query is directly related to Windows Phone, I would suggest you to post in the community of Windows Phone, where you can get more experienced
    responses:
    http://answers.microsoft.com/en-us/winphone
    The reason why we recommend posting appropriately is you will get the most qualified pool of respondents, and other partners who read the forums regularly can either share their knowledge or learn from your interaction with us. Thank you for your understanding.
    Regards,
    Ethan Hua
    TechNet Community Support
    It's recommended to download and install
    Configuration Analyzer Tool (OffCAT), which is developed by Microsoft Support teams. Once the tool is installed, you can run it at any time to scan for hundreds of known issues in Office
    programs.

  • How to populate data in fields from the same cube

    HI Gurs,
    Need some help. I have a cube it has 11 key figures . Data for 7 of those is coming from another cube for rest of the 4 we need to calculate from two of those 7 fields. e.g.
    Field 1= Field2(First Cube) - Field3(FirstCube)
    Field4= Field5(FirstCube)/1.5
    Field 6 = Field1 / Field4
    I need to pupulate field 4 in the final cube.
    How can I achieve this?
    Can anyone please suggest anything?

    Hi Ray,
    One is as suggested by surendra i.e to populate thru End routine,take help of an ABAPer and do it.
    Else just add the new 4 KF  in the New Cube i.e Cube 2 and in the Individual Routine /Field Routine you can write the same Formula in the  Result of it.Say,For Fields 1 you have to have Field 2,Field 3 and Field 5 as input ,which you hvae include manually in the Individual/Field Routine.
    In Result for Field 1= Field2(First Cube) - Field3(FirstCube)
    In Result for Field4= Field5(FirstCube)/1.5
    In Result for Field 6 = (Field2(First Cube) - Field3(FirstCube) / Field5(FirstCube)/1.5)
    Hope you got it ....
    Rgds
    SVU123

  • How to find where the data is coming from in appended field for BW extract

    I am not an ABAP'er ... And this problem is about a BW Extractor
    I am extracting data for my (Utility Industry) Sales Statistics Cube using 0UC_SALES_STATS_01 data source. The Extract structure is BIW_ISU_ESTA and we are appending the structure with a few fields:
    I_ZAHL1
    I_ZAHL2
    I_ZAHL3
    I see some similar fields in DBERCHZ1 which are not the same. The data gets filled in the above fields somehow. I need to find out how and where. We have now diffrent variation of the same data and I'd like to extract that transactional data as well using the same fields rather than appending more fields to an already huge extract structure. When I click on the fields in BIW_ISU_ESTA, it takes me no where. I also tried out the extractor program (RSA3) in debug mode but somehow the fields are already populated. I tried using the ABAP dictinary but can't find a way to find these fields there.
    Any help would be appreciated.
    Thanks a lot.
    Bilal

    Thanks Renata,
    This is a standard business content extractor with the fields enhanced. Usually we have some user exits to populate the fields but in this case we only append the extract table. I couldn't see these fields being part of any existing includes in the extract struct but some how they get populated. I guess system knows from where to copy the data.
    Thanks for your reply though. I am closing this thread as it seems not a very popular cube.
    Bilal

Maybe you are looking for

  • Firefox will not open. Can't update or delete. Says it's already open and I am unable to find how to close it.

    Firefox shows notice that it is already open and must be closed in order to update or delete. I can't locate a place to close the process. It's probably something very simple but I am not a computer genius. Thanks!

  • How can I re-release the Customizing request

    Hi, Yesterday, I released a customizing request to QAS. At the QAS, I used the T-code STMS to check the import request, I could not find out it. But, today, I released another customizing request to QAS. I can find out it. I don't known what had happ

  • Other _root solution

    Hello, I'm coverting my code from AS2 to AS3. I have public variables I've declared on my main ".as" that I've always used in my custom classes by saying _root.varname. Of course _root is gone, so I was wondering if the code I have below is the best

  • My pencil (drawing program) is too slow!

    I have a "pencil" function similar to the one in paint() where I press the mouse and it draws on a JPanel. However, pretty quickly it gets slow and the drawing can't keep up with the mouseDragged events. How can I make this faster? this is my class r

  • Media Manager Flex View Library upload crash

    The Flex View library upload option crashes whenever I try to upload anything.  I have Mac OS X Lion and am trying to sync my iPhoto library  Which is 20 Gb ie well below the 32Gb limit.  As soon as the upload starts the program quits unexpectedly.